int c = 0; while(!feof(fp)){ fscanf(fp,"%s %s %d %d %d %d %d\n",&stu[c].snum,&stu[c].sname,&stu[c].chinese,&stu[c].math,&stu[c].english,&stu[c].sumcj,&stu[c].rank); stu[c].sumcj = stu[c].chinese + stu[c].math + stu[c].english; c++; } fclose(fp); /...
); /* 输入学号及三门课程的成绩 */ average = (float)(Chinese + Math + English) / 3; /* 计算平均成绩 */ }puts("\n学号 语文 数学 英语 平均分"); for (i = 0; i < num; i++) { /* 输出每个学生的成绩信息 */ printf("%d %d %d %d %.2f\n", StudentID, Chinese, Math, Engl...
1,输入模块:主要完成将数据存入一个数据文件中,在本管理系统中,记录可以以二进制形式存储的数据文件读入,也可以从键盘逐个输入学生记录。 2,查询模块:主要完成查找满足相关条件的学生记录,用户可以按学生的学号或者姓名进行查找。 3,更新模块:主要完成对学生记录的维护,实现对学生记录的修改、删除、插入和排序操作。
c语言学生成绩管理系统代码 #include<stdio.h> #include<string.h> #include<stdlib.h> #defineMAXN100//一个班最多的人数 #defineMAXM2//成绩的课程门数 intR; voidinput();//1.学生成绩新建 voidsort();//2.学生成绩插入 voidload();//3.学生成绩修改 voidprint();//4.学生成绩删除 voidtotal();/...
C 以下是用C语言编写的学生成绩管理系统的简单代码,可以用vc运行(供参考) #include"stdio.h" #include”stdlib。h" #include"string。h” typedefstructstudent//定义学生 { charname[10]; intnumber; charsex[2]; intmath; integlish; intclanguge; intaverage;...
1、C 程序 学生管理系统/* Note:Your choice is C IDE */#include "stdio.h"#include "stdlib.h"#include "string.h" typedef struct student / 定义学生 char name10;int number;char sex2;int math;int eglish;int clanguge;int average; student;typedef struct unit / 定义接点student date;struct ...
@文心快码BaiduComate学生成绩管理系统c语言代码 文心快码BaiduComate 以下是一个简单的学生成绩管理系统的C语言代码示例,包含了添加、查询、修改、删除学生成绩等基本功能。 1. 定义学生数据结构 首先,我们定义一个学生数据结构,包含学生姓名、学号和成绩等信息: c #include <stdio.h> #include <stdlib....
代码实现 学生成绩管理系统 效果图 结构图 流程图 流程&注意要点 核心部分——EasyX显示图形界面,结构体数组和文件操作负责对数据进行各种操作。 只要一进去程序就对存储数据的文件进行读取,如果有数据直接读到学生结构体数组里面,得到当前结构体数组中的数据数量(几个人),并将所有数据打印到屏幕上。
以下是一个简单的C语言学生成绩管理系统示例,实现了查询、添加、修改和删除学生成绩等功能。您可以修改和扩展该代码以满足您的需求: #include <stdio.h> #include <stdlib.h> #include <string.h> typedef struct { int id; char name[20]; float score; } Student; void display_menu(); void add_...
大学C语言实训课的第一课:C语言学生成绩管理系统。 #include<stdio.h>#include<string.h>#include<math.h>structstudent{intnum;charname[20];floatpingshi;floatshiyan;floatkaoshi;doublezongping;}stu[4];voidmain(){voida();voidb();voidc();voidd();voide();intn;while(n!=6){printf("\t大学计...